Cabinet Secretary Opiyo Wandayi, an influential ODM member and a respected figure in Ugunja constituency, has made a bold and thoughtful political decision to support President William Ruto for re-election in 2027. This choice exemplifies leadership that prioritizes performance, inclusivity, and grassroots-driven development over party loyalty. Wandayi’s endorsement reflects not only his personal conviction but also the voice of his constituency, which admires leadership that delivers tangible results and understands local realities deeply. The candidacy of Moses, recognized for his profound knowledge of Ugunja’s unique dynamics, adds credibility and strength to this alliance, marking a vital moment for democratic evolution in Kenya.
CS Wandayi’s alignment with President Ruto arises from clear evidence of transformative leadership that has redefined the socio-economic framework in Kenya. The President’s commitment to the bottom-up economic model has empowered thousands of grassroots entrepreneurs, smallholder farmers, and youth-led enterprises nationwide. This model dismantles historic barriers to economic participation and decentralizes opportunities, promoting equitable growth and sustainable livelihoods. Under this leadership, infrastructure development such as roads, water projects, and access to markets has accelerated, directly benefiting constituencies like Ugunja where socio-economic transformation is eagerly awaited. Wandayi’s decision to support this leadership is rooted in the desire to see these positive transformations continue without interruption.
